How Much Caffeine Is In A Cappuccino?

Macchiatos have just 85 mg of caffeine every 2-ounce (60-gram) drink, but cappuccinos and lattes each contain around 173 mg of caffeine each 16-ounce (480-gram) serving.

How much caffeine is in a cappuccino vs coffee?

As you saw before, the average cappuccino has around 80 mg of caffeine. It is also essential to take into consideration the amount of coffee that you are consuming. The amount of caffeine in a cup of coffee that is 12 ounces contains close to 300 mg, whereas the amount of caffeine in a cup of cappuccino that is 12 ounces and is produced with two shots of espresso has close to 160 mg.

How long does cappuccino keep you awake?

The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) estimates that the half-life of caffeine ranges between four and six hours.This implies that up to six hours after consuming a caffeinated beverage, half of the caffeine you drank will still be present in your body, which will keep you attentive for the duration of that time.And, if it’s time for bed, preventing you from going asleep when you should be.

Which has more caffeine espresso or cappuccino?

The amount of caffeine in an espresso is more than that of a cappuccino, however this is only the case if your cappuccino contains just one shot of espresso. If it is made with two shots of espresso, a cappuccino will have more caffeine than an espresso made with only one shot.

Which coffee has the least caffeine?

Decaffeinated coffee, which is at least 97 percent devoid of caffeine, contains the least amount of caffeine of any type of coffee.A single shot of espresso is the type of coffee beverage that has the least amount of caffeine among those that contain normal coffee.In comparison, the amount of caffeine in a single shot of espresso is 45 milligrams, while a cup of drip filter coffee contains 95 milligrams.

Is cappuccino healthier than coffee?

A cup of cappuccino will often have more calories than a cup of black coffee since it has extra components, such as frothed milk and hot milk, in addition to the coffee. However, the quantity of sugar and milk you put in your coffee, such as whole milk or plant-based milk, can make it just as calorically dense as a cappuccino or even more so.

Which is healthier cappuccino or latte?

Good: Cappuccino ″A cappuccino is somewhat lower in calories than a latte or flat white at 110 calories and six grams of fat with full cream milk,″ notes Burrell. ″However, because to the milk/froth ratio, a cappuccino includes slightly less calcium than a latte or flat white.″

How much caffeine should you have in a day?

The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has identified a daily intake of 400 milligrams of caffeine, which is equivalent to around four or five cups of coffee, as a level that is not frequently linked with harmful or bad consequences.On the other hand, there is a large amount of variance between individuals in terms of how sensitive they are to the effects of caffeine and how quickly they metabolize it (break it down).
